Step 1: Private

A Private Pilot Certificate (PPL) is the first major milestone in a pilot's training, allowing the holder to act as the pilot in command of an aircraft for non-commercial purposes. To obtain a PPL, pilots must complete a minimum of 40 flight hours, including 20 hours of flight instruction and 10 hours of solo flight, along with passing a written knowledge test and a practical flight test. This certification provides the foundational skills needed for further advanced ratings and is a prerequisite for pursuing a career in aviation​.

Step 2: Instrument

An Instrument Rating (IR) is a crucial certification for pilots, allowing them to fly under instrument flight rules (IFR), which is essential for operating in poor weather conditions where visibility is limited.

Step 3: Commercial

A Commercial Pilot License (CPL) allows pilots to be compensated for their flying services and opens up various career opportunities in aviation. To obtain a CPL, pilots must complete both ground and flight training, which includes advanced topics in meteorology, navigation, and complex flight maneuvers. The training typically requires a minimum of 250 flight hours under Part 61 regulations, or 190 hours under Part 141 regulations​.

Step 4: CFI

A Certified Flight Instructor (CFI) rating enables experienced pilots to teach aspiring aviators both the theoretical and practical aspects of flying. The CFI training program includes comprehensive ground school to cover the fundamentals of instruction and aeronautical knowledge, alongside extensive flight training where candidates learn to teach various maneuvers and flight operations from the instructor's seat. Earning a CFI rating not only enhances a pilot's teaching capabilities but also deepens their own understanding of aviation, offering opportunities to shape the next generation of pilots and contribute significantly to aviation safety and education​.

Step 5: CFII

A Certified Flight Instructor Instrument (CFII) rating allows flight instructors to teach instrument rating applicants both on the ground and in flight, enhancing their ability to fly in instrument meteorological conditions (IMC). The CFII training involves a combination of ground and flight instruction, focusing on advanced instrument flight procedures, navigation systems, and emergency operations. This certification not only improves a pilot's instructional skills but also their own proficiency and situational awareness in instrument flying, making it a valuable credential for those looking to advance their aviation careers​.

Step 6: Comm. Multi.

The Commercial Multi-Engine Rating is a crucial certification for pilots aiming to advance their careers by flying aircraft with more than one engine. This rating enhances a pilot's proficiency in managing the complexities of multi-engine operations, such as handling engine-out procedures and asymmetric thrust. It also provides significant performance benefits, including increased speed, power, and rate of climb, making it an essential step for those pursuing careers in commercial aviation and wanting to operate more advanced and powerful aircraft.
